Inflatable protection film
Technical Field
The invention relates to the technical field of protective films, in particular to an inflatable protective film.
Background
The protective film can be divided into a digital product protective film, an automobile protective film, a household protective film, a food fresh-keeping protective film and the like according to the application. With the popularization of digital products such as mobile phones in China, the protective film has become a general name of screen protective film slowly, and the common PE film on the market at present is soft in material and has certain stretchability. The thickness is generally 0.05MM-0.15MM, the viscosity is different from 5G-500G according to the use requirement, an electrostatic film, a reticulate pattern film and the like are arranged under the protection film item made of PE materials, generally, when the valuables are packed and transported, an inflatable protection film is required to be wrapped outside, the inflatable protection film is attached to the outside of the valuables, and when the valuables are extruded or collided, good shock absorption can be formed under the elastic action of the protection film, so that the damage to the valuables is avoided.
However, most of the existing inflatable protective films are disposable articles, so that the waste phenomenon is easy to generate, meanwhile, the existing inflatable protective films are single in structure, on one hand, articles are protected mostly from the outside, a good effect cannot be achieved when the articles are protected, on the other hand, the protective films are broken and lose the protection effect due to the fact that the protective films are easily abraded with contact objects in the moving or transporting process, and therefore the existing requirements are not met, and the inflatable protective films are provided.
Disclosure of Invention
The present invention provides an inflatable protective film to solve the problem of the prior art that the protective effect of the inflatable protective film is poor due to the single structure.
In order to achieve the purpose, the invention provides the following technical scheme: an inflatable protective film comprises a film body, wherein a containing main cavity is arranged inside the film body, containing sub-cavities are arranged inside the containing main cavity, and a plurality of the containing sub-cavities are arranged, connecting parts are arranged among the containing sub-cavities, sealing and fixing mechanisms are arranged inside the connecting parts, the upper end and the lower end of the film body are both provided with sealing edges, one side of the sealing edge at the upper end of the film body is provided with a seal, the outside of the seal is provided with a sealing zipper, and the sealing zipper is connected with the sealing in a sliding way, one side of the front end of the film body is provided with two first thread gluing pastes, the first thread gluing paster is fixedly adhered with the membrane body, the outer part of the membrane body is hermetically fixed with an inflating mechanism, the front ends of the containing sub-cavities are all provided with exhaust valves, and the exhaust valve and the film body are sealed and fixed, and the film body consists of a base material layer, a flame-retardant layer and a wear-resistant anti-corrosion layer.

Preferably, the inside of inflating the mechanism is provided with the air inlet, and the air inlet is linked together with accomodating total chamber, the inside of air inlet is provided with the fixed plate, the inside of fixed plate is the annular array and sets up there is the gas pocket, the fixed sleeve that is provided with in upper end of fixed plate, telescopic inside slidable mounting has the bracing piece, the fixed spring that is provided with between bracing piece and the sleeve, the fixed sealing plug that is provided with in upper end of bracing piece, the inside upper end of air inlet is provided with the dog, and dog and sealing plug looks adaptation.
Preferably, the upper end of the inflating mechanism is provided with a clamping groove, a sealing cover is arranged inside the clamping groove and is in threaded fit with the clamping groove, a plunger is arranged at the lower end of the sealing cover, and the plunger is attached to the upper end of the air inlet.
Preferably, the filter screen is installed to the upper end of dog, and the filter screen passes through the draw-in groove with the air inlet and fixes.
Preferably, the flame retardant layer comprises the following components: styrene-acrylic emulsion, ammonium polyphosphate, starch hexa-Australian cyclododecane, dicyandiamide, aluminum phosphate, ethyl dicyclic acid, cyclohexyl methyl phosphate, dimethyl methyl phosphate, dicyclopentanyl methyl phosphate and water.
Preferably, the composition of the wear-resistant and corrosion-resistant layer comprises: dioctyl phthalate, lead sulfate tribasic, 203 phenolic resin, polyvinyl chloride resin, calcium oxide, titanium dioxide, nano active calcium carbonate and fumed silica.

Compared with the prior art, the invention has the beneficial effects that:
1. the invention places articles by adopting a mode of inner and outer double wrapping, when wrapping conventional articles, firstly opening the inflating mechanism to inflate the interior of the film body, after the inflation is finished, placing the articles on one surface of the first thread gluing sticker, gradually rolling the film body along one end of the first thread gluing sticker to enable the whole film body to be converted into a columnar structure, after the rolling is finished, sticking the first thread gluing on one surface and the second thread gluing attached to the other surface of the film body, wherein the bristles with hooks on the first thread gluing can tightly hook the limit on the second thread gluing sticker to form fixation, so that the columnar film body is prevented from loosening, the transportation is convenient, when placing the easily oxidized articles, the sealing is opened by opening the sealing zipper, the articles to be protected are placed in the containing main cavity, because the containing main cavity consists of a plurality of containing sub-cavities, the space sizes of the containing sub-cavities can be adjusted by the sealing and fixing mechanism according to the sizes of the articles, when moving to suitable position, aerify accomodating total intracavity portion through aerifing the mechanism, gas can be selected according to the type of protected article, it is enough to aerify the completion, close and aerify the mechanism, simultaneously seal sealed fixed establishment according to the article size, unnecessary part passes through discharge valve with gaseous exhaust, through this kind of mode, can not only be to carrying out nimble selection between outer parcel and the interior parcel, simultaneously including on the parcel, can be according to the size of article, the kind is divided in a flexible way, make holistic protective properties obtain promoting.

4. According to the invention, the inflating mechanism is arranged, when inflation is carried out, the sealing cover is taken down, the inflating equipment is connected to the clamping groove, the sealing plug is extruded by pressurizing gas, the sealing plug is driven to shrink towards the inside of the sleeve by the gas, a gap is generated between the sealing plug and the stop block, the gas can enter the containing main cavity from the gap through the gas inlet, inflation work is realized, after inflation is finished, the sealing plug is ejected towards the upper end again under the reset action of the spring due to the reduction of the gas pressure, the sealing plug is attached to the stop block again, the sealing of the gas inlet is formed, gas leakage is avoided, meanwhile, the sealing cover is covered, and the plunger at the lower end of the sealing cover can further improve the sealing performance.

Further, an air inlet 22 is arranged inside the inflating mechanism 9, the air inlet 22 is communicated with the containing main cavity 2, a fixing plate 23 is arranged inside the air inlet 22, an air hole 24 is formed in the fixing plate 23 in an annular array, a sleeve 30 is fixedly arranged at the upper end of the fixing plate 23, a support rod 31 is slidably arranged inside the sleeve 30, a spring 32 is fixedly arranged between the support rod 31 and the sleeve 30, a sealing plug 29 is fixedly arranged at the upper end of the support rod 31, a stop 33 is arranged at the upper end inside the air inlet 22, the stop 33 is matched with the sealing plug 29, air presses the sealing plug 29 to enable the sealing plug 31 to contract towards the inside of the sleeve 30 through pressurization, a gap is formed between the stop 29 and the stop 33, the air can enter the containing main cavity 2 through the air inlet 22 from the gap, inflating work is realized, and after inflating is finished, under the reset action of the spring 32, the sealing plug 29 is ejected out towards the upper end again, so that the sealing plug is attached to the stop 33 again to form a seal for the air inlet 22, and air is prevented from leaking.
Further, a clamping groove 26 is formed in the upper end of the inflating mechanism 9, a sealing cover 25 is mounted inside the clamping groove 26, the sealing cover 25 is in threaded fit with the clamping groove 26, a plunger 27 is arranged at the lower end of the sealing cover 25, the plunger 27 is attached to the upper end of the air inlet 22, and the plunger 27 at the lower end of the sealing cover 25 can further improve the sealing performance of the inflating mechanism 9.
Further, filter screen 28 is installed to the upper end of dog 33, and filter screen 28 passes through the draw-in groove with air inlet 22 and fixes, and filter screen 28 can block the impurity in the gas, guarantees to accomodate the inside cleanness in total chamber 2.
Further, the composition of the flame retardant layer 20 includes: the styrene-acrylic emulsion, the ammonium polyphosphate, the starch hexa-Australian cyclododecane, the dicyandiamide, the aluminum phosphate, the ethyl dicyclic phosphoric acid, the methyl cyclohexyl phosphate, the methyl dimethyl phosphate, the methyl dicyclopentyl phosphate and the water are attached to the surface of the substrate layer 19, so that the substrate layer 19 is soft in hand feeling and high in safety, the structure of the substrate layer 19 is not damaged, and the substrate layer 19 is endowed with good flame retardant property.
Further, the composition of the wear-resistant and corrosion-resistant layer 21 includes: dioctyl phthalate, lead sulfate tribasic, 203 phenolic resin, polyvinyl chloride resin, calcium oxide, titanium dioxide, nanometer active calcium carbonate and fumed silica, this kind of modified coating has good adhesive force, be difficult for taking place to drop with whole, in addition itself has the pliability, can cooperate along with the inflation shrinkage of substrate layer 19 and fire-retardant layer 20, fold or fracture phenomenon can not appear, on this basis then, give the membrane body good wearability, the corrosion resistance, improved holistic life, be convenient for use for a long time.
